ZIP Code 12529 – United States

ZIP Code 12529 belongs to Hillsdale, NY. The table below show the information about the city, county, state, latitude, longitude of ZIP code 12529.

ZIP Code12529
PlaceHillsdale
CountyColumbia
StateNew York
Latitude42.1868
Longitude-73.5483
